The Kalamazoo College baseball team was awarded the 2021-22 American Baseball Coaches Association's Team Academic Excellence Award for achieving a 3.49 team grade point average this academic year.

The ABCA recognizes teams with a minimum cumulative GPA of 3.0 or higher for the academic year.

Kalamazoo finished the season with a record of 27-13, the second-most wins in school history. The Hornets earned their first NCAA III Tournament victory in their second appearance after winning the MIAA Tournament championship.

The American Baseball Coaches Association has a long tradition of recognizing the achievements of baseball coaches and student-athletes. The ABCA/Rawlings All-America Teams are the nation's oldest, founded in 1949, and the ABCA's awards program also includes the ABCA/Rawlings All-Region Awards, the ABCA/Diamond Sports Regional & National Coaches of the Year and several other major awards such as the ABCA Hall of Fame and Dave Keilitz Ethics in Coaching Award.
